Eccezione non gestita DataVisualization

di il
4 risposte

Eccezione non gestita DataVisualization

Ciao, sono nuovo del forum e non sono un programmatore (né X formazione né X professione) ma sto creando dei piccoli programmi in vb.net ad uso mio e del mio ufficio...
Ho appena terminato la prima bozza (completa e distribuibile ) di un programma, ma nell'ultimo test prima della distribuzione (avvio dell'eseguibile su un pc diverso da quelli che uso x programmare) il prog genera un'eccezione non gestita...
Credo che il problema sia legato ad un Chart presente nel form (child) in fase di inizializzazione...
Contesto:
- programmo con Visual Basic 2008 Express,
- .Net Framework 3.5 sp1
- sui due pc che uso x programmare il problema non si è mai verificato, né in debug ("play" da vb2008 express) né avviando l'eseguibile generato dal build

Riporto di seguito l'estratto del msg di errore:
************** Exception Text **************
System.IO.FileNotFoundException: Could not load file or assembly 'System.Windows.Forms.DataVisualization, Version=3.5.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' or one of its dependencies. The system cannot find the file specified. File name: 'System.Windows.Forms.DataVisualization, Version=3.5.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35' at RefineryCorrosion.HTHA.InitializeComponent()
...
potete aiutarmi?

Grazie!

4 Risposte

  • Re: Eccezione non gestita DataVisualization

    Ciao,
    hai referenziato le librerie e copiato nel pacchetto tutti i file DLL?.

    Ciao Lele
  • Re: Eccezione non gestita DataVisualization

    lele2006 ha scritto:


    Ciao,
    hai referenziato le librerie e copiato nel pacchetto tutti i file DLL?.

    Ciao Lele
    Si, in effetti avevo risolto il problema in questo modo.
    Il file dall viene copiato nella cartella bin/release insieme all'exe (preferisco la distribuzione dei file, dos-style, piuttosto che il click-once publish)

    Ma è possibile in qualche modo includere il dll nell'exe stesso? In modo da poter distribuire un solo file "tutto incluso"?

    Grazie!
  • Re: Eccezione non gestita DataVisualization

    Ciao,
    dipende se sul pc che stai installando il computer è installato il Framework.
  • Re: Eccezione non gestita DataVisualization

    4sentieri ha scritto:


    lele2006 ha scritto:


    Ciao,
    hai referenziato le librerie e copiato nel pacchetto tutti i file DLL?.

    Ciao Lele
    Si, in effetti avevo risolto il problema in questo modo.
    Il file dall viene copiato nella cartella bin/release insieme all'exe (preferisco la distribuzione dei file, dos-style, piuttosto che il click-once publish)

    Ma è possibile in qualche modo includere il dll nell'exe stesso? In modo da poter distribuire un solo file "tutto incluso"?

    Grazie!
    Puoi usare un installer (ne esistono di gratuiti) che fa un pacchetto unico per l'installazione di tutti i files che servono.
Devi accedere o registrarti per scrivere nel forum
4 risposte